Transaction c308090cbda33dbb72cb56f684732c04584eb869a2d313697eb0aa2e21366c34
1 Input
1 Output
-
c308090cbda33dbb72cb56f684732c04584eb869a2d313697eb0aa2e21366c34:0
- value
- 99950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 464c9c555113c37976ee8190ead6dc90dddebb08 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Qi5S1ojdjMyaGZ11gj9EhXWeHVAnCuiy